Avoca Dell · Suburb / Locality
Work across the area — who is in the labour force, in which industries and jobs.
A much higher share of adults are working or looking for work in Avoca Dell compared to the rest of the country. While 68.9% of the local adult population is active in the workforce, the unemployment rate of 6.0% is also much higher than in most similar areas.
Employment, participation and unemployment.
Full-time employment is common here, with 60.5% of the workforce in full-time roles, which is well above the South Australian figure of 57.2%. This strong employment rate sits alongside a local unemployment rate that is about the same as the national figure.

The industries that employ local workers.
The most common industries for local workers are health care and social assistance at 18.5%, followed by construction at 11.1% and manufacturing at 9.9%.
The kinds of jobs people do.
Clerical and administrative roles are the most frequent occupations at 19.8%, while technicians and trades make up 17.3% of the workforce.
